IPO Market

A highly anticipated IPO that has been in the works for quite some time looks to be coming to the finish line and hitting public markets. Social media platform, Reddit has reportedly released the details of its upcoming IPO. Reddit’s IPO comes more than 2 years after the company originally planned to go public. Morgan Stanley, Goldman Sachs, JP Morgan, and Bank of America are serving as the lead underwriters for the offering.

The company targets a valuation of up to $6.4 billion. The company will look to raise $748 million in the offering. Reddit will look to sell 22 million shares (a combination of issue and sales) at a price between $31 and $34.

The pricing information comes a few weeks after it was announced that Reddit had applied to the New York Stock Exchange for its IPO. Reddit will trade under the ticker RDDT.
